Hizb militant killed in Pulwama gunfight

Pulwama, Oct 13: A Hizbul Mujhaideen militant was killed in a gunfight at Babagund village in south Kashmir’s Pulwama district on Saturday. Another militant reportedly injured in the gunfight was admitted in a Srinagar hospital.

“Militants attacked an army Casper vehicle at around 1 am past night and fled from the spot. Soon after the attack, troops of 55 RR, CRPF and SOG laid a siege around the Babagund village and started door to door searches,” a police official told ‘Kashmir Images’.

He said “during searches, the militants hiding in the residential house of one Mohammad Shafi Hafiz, son of Abdul Gaffar Hafiz, fired at the government forces which triggered a gunfight in which one militant was killed and another escaped in injured condition.”

The militant killed during encounter was identified as Shabir Ahmad Dar alias Maali, son of Ghulam Mohammad Dar, resident of Samboora village in Pulwama district.

Shabir had joined militant ranks in 2016 and is survived by father, mother, two sisters and two brothers.

“Irfan Ahmad Dar, the elder brother of the slain militant was arrested three months back in a nocturnal raid at his house and was slapped with Public Safety Act (PSA) and shifted to Kathua jail,” said Malla Begum, mother of the slain militant.

“As soon as the body of the slain militant reached to his native village Samboora, thousands of people from adjacent village thronged there and participated in his funeral prayers,” locals said.

“As many as three rounds of funeral prayers were offered to the slain militant with thousands of men, women and children chanting pro-freedom and pro-Pakistan slogans” said an eyewitness.

Another witness said that a few militants appeared in the funeral of the slain militant and offered gun salutes to their fallen colleague.

“Another militant who was injured in the gunfight at Babagund village was shifted to SMHS Hospital in Srinagar for treatment by some unknown persons” said a police official.

The injured militant was identified as Showkat Ahmad Dar, son of Nazir Ahmad Dar, resident of Murran village of the Pulwama district.

The officer said that Showkat was admitted by some unknown persons who wrote his name as Bashir Ahmad in the hospital registry.

According to a doctor, Dar has received a bullet wound in his abdomen which severely damaged his internal organs. The doctor said his condition is very critical.

The police officer said they have taken cognizance and further action is being taken.

Meanwhile, in Pulwama district magistrate imposed restrictions under Section 144 CrPC in the town as announcement was made on loudspeakers by government forces on early Saturday morning.

All the exit and entry points were sealed with concertina wires by the government forces.
